Exploring Government Grants for Business Expansion
Have you considered tapping into government grants to fund your expansion plans?
Why Choose Grants:
- No Repayment: Unlike loans, grants provide free capital for your business.
- Encouragement for Innovation: Governments often target businesses in technology, sustainability, or job creation sectors.
- Support for Specific Initiatives: Many grants focus on underrepresented groups, rural areas, or green initiatives.
Examples of Grant Opportunities in 2025:
- Small Business Innovation Research (SBIR): Provides funding for technology-driven small businesses.
- Rural Development Grants: Supports businesses expanding into underserved areas.
- Green Technology Grants: Funds businesses contributing to sustainability and energy efficiency.
Applying for grants requires a compelling proposal and careful alignment with the grant’s objectives. Despite the competition, the financial freedom they offer makes them worth pursuing.
The Power of Small Business Loans for Scaling Up
Are you hesitant to take on debt, even if it means fueling your growth? Small business loans remain a trusted option for expansion.
Loan Types to Consider:
- SBA Loans: Backed by the government, offering low interest rates and favorable terms.
- Traditional Bank Loans: Ideal for businesses with strong credit and financial history.
- Online Lenders: Provide quick access to funds with flexible requirements.
Keys to Securing a Loan:
- Develop a detailed business plan outlining your expansion goals.
- Present clear financial projections demonstrating repayment ability.
- Build a strong credit profile to secure better interest rates.
Loans provide immediate access to capital, empowering you to take decisive action on your growth strategies.
Equity Financing: Partnering for Growth
Have you ever thought about bringing in investors to fund your expansion? Equity financing allows you to sell a stake in your business to raise capital.
Benefits of Equity Financing:
- No Repayment Obligation: Unlike loans, you don’t owe investors monthly payments.
- Access to Expertise: Investors often provide mentorship, connections, and industry insights.
- Rapid Growth Potential: Significant funding accelerates your ability to scale.
Investor Types to Explore:
- Venture Capitalists: Invest in businesses with high growth potential.
- Angel Investors: Provide early-stage funding, often in exchange for equity.
- Private Equity Firms: Focus on established businesses looking to expand aggressively.
Equity financing is ideal for businesses willing to share ownership in exchange for substantial capital and support.
Crowdfunding: Turning Public Support into Capital
Have you underestimated the power of a supportive community? Crowdfunding connects businesses with customers and investors, enabling them to raise funds while building brand loyalty.
Crowdfunding Platforms to Leverage:
- Kickstarter: Ideal for product-based businesses offering rewards for contributions.
- Indiegogo: Flexible options for various business types.
- Crowdcube: Focuses on equity-based crowdfunding for startups.
Why Crowdfunding Works:
- Engage directly with your target audience.
- Generate buzz and brand awareness.
- Build a loyal customer base that’s invested in your success.
A successful crowdfunding campaign not only raises funds but also validates your business idea in the marketplace.
Tax Incentives and Credits: Hidden Funding Opportunities
Did you know that tax incentives can indirectly fund your business expansion? Governments worldwide offer tax breaks and credits for businesses contributing to job creation, sustainability, or innovation.
Examples of Tax Incentives:
- Research & Development (R&D) Credits: Offset costs associated with innovation.
- Energy Efficiency Credits: Reward businesses adopting green technologies.
- Employment-Based Incentives: Encourage hiring in underserved communities.
Working with a knowledgeable accountant ensures you maximize these opportunities, freeing up capital for growth.

FAQs: Addressing Common Funding Concerns
Q: Are grants difficult to obtain?
A: While competitive, grants are achievable with a strong proposal that aligns with the grant’s objectives.
Q: What’s the risk of equity financing?
A: Sharing ownership means giving up some control, but the trade-off is access to significant capital and expertise.
Q: How do I improve my chances of loan approval?
A: Maintain a strong credit score, present detailed financial projections, and build a compelling business case.
Q: Is crowdfunding suitable for all businesses?
A: Crowdfunding works best for businesses with a compelling story or innovative product that resonates with a broad audience.
